All Categories
Featured
Table of Contents
For instance, the Leetcode system is used for the online coding round. We permit you to pick a shows language you are most comfortable with during the coding difficulty. We also use Google Jamboard for the design round. All the rounds are performed online. Our interview process at Opn is straightforward, and we guarantee you are well-prepared for the technical rounds.
The technical interview includes two rounds: (a) the coding round and (b) the style round, each lasting one hour. You will certainly have 50 minutes to react to inquiries and 10 minutes for Q&A. Relying on the availability of both the prospect and the recruiter, these rounds might occur on various days.
Perhaps, it has actually been a very long time because you last touched them, so take enough time to go back to practice. Recognize the concepts, examine the phrase structure really carefully, and get aware of different means of responding to the questions. Throughout the interview, before attempting to write your remedy, you may wish to initial clarify the inquiry with the interviewer, evaluate the problem, and detail the logic and why you will certainly choose this method to solving the issue.
It is essential to point out that the recruiters desire you to do well and exist to sustain you. Rationale for you is to show the interviewer how you assume, communicate, and whether you can solve problems. By doing so, you have actually opened up the floor to involve more with the interviewer and invite any kind of ideas linked with dealing with the coding troubles.
Still, it prevails among our interviewers to ask inquiries around the topic of payment portals as this will certainly be most relevant to your day-to-day job. In the layout round, prospects are encouraged to provide their ideal software application style style to apply a hypothetical solution under certain restrictions. Inquiries can include: Design a repayment system for an ecommerce system.
When being spoken with and during coding rounds, it's valuable to repeat the inquiries to the recruiter to make certain that both of you are on the same page. If you do not recognize, feel free to ask the job interviewer to repeat or put in other words the question.
I've been a full desk technical recruiter for almost 10 years. Many of my time has actually been spent as a firm employer with Code Ability, however I likewise have a year of interior recruiting experience on Twitter's Revenue Platform group.
I 'd such as to flag that the guidance given is based upon my individual opinions and experience, and must not be considered an endorsement of the employing processes used in huge tech, or by companies mimicing large tech hiring. Rather, it is intended to provide support on how to navigate the "industry criterion" interview process and enhance your opportunities of success.
Yet in all severity, you can tell a whole lot regarding your alignment to a firm and their worths based upon this page. Furthermore, websites like Glassdoor and Blind can provide useful understandings into the business's interview procedure, staff member experiences, and salaries. It's also a good idea to investigate your interviewer and their duty to get a far better understanding of their perspective and what they may be seeking in a candidate.
How has the interview process been so much? Typically our instincts are powerful tools that are neglected; it's essential to resolve any type of appointments about the function or company prior to proceeding with the procedure.
Treat every practice as an interview; it may also aid with those video game day nerves! In the 'Understanding is Power' section, I discussed the relevance of determining firm worths. When you have actually determined them, produce STAR method examples for each of those values. I particularly love the STAR approach because it permits exact and example-heavy answers.
In addition, the STAR approach will certainly aid you produce answers to possible behavior meeting concerns. Come up with celebrity examples for each and every bullet in the task description (if there are also several bullets, collect themes). Behavior interview concerns are typically taken straight from these task summary bullet factors. As an example: Solid problem-solving abilities, with the ability to believe artistically and purposefully to fix complicated technical difficulties -> Tell me regarding a time you ran into challenges and difficulties at work.
By showing excellent partnership skills, explaining their believed processes, and most significantly, their errors. During the technical meeting, keep these concerns in mind: Have you collected your needs? Are you inspecting in with your recruiter?
Ask for a minute. It's okay to take a break. Being sincere and susceptible (when risk-free) can aid you stand out from other prospects.
Remember, you're freaking awesome, and your one-of-a-kind high qualities and experiences can help you land your dream job so long as it's the appropriate suitable for you. Are you still not really feeling great about this? All good, and I completely understand. Here's a checklist of business that do not whiteboard or follow "common tech" interview processes, phew.
Do inspect out all these concerns with solutions from below: Software Application Design Meeting Questions is the process of making, developing, testing, and keeping software application. It is a methodical and disciplined technique to software growth that aims to develop high-quality, trusted, and maintainable software program. Software application designers develop software application remedies for end users by using design concepts and their understanding of programming languages.
It is an attributes of software application that describes its capability to do what it was created to do properly and regularly over time. It refers to the level to which the software application can be utilized with convenience. The amount of effort or time called for to learn exactly how to utilize the software application.
It describes exactly how simple it is to boost and customize the software program. It refers to exactly how conveniently a software program system can be modified to include function, improve speed, or repair work mistakes. It describes exactly how well the software application can deal with various platforms or scenarios without making significant alterations.
For more information please describe the adhering to write-up Features of Software. The software application is made use of extensively in numerous domain names including health centers, financial institutions, schools, defense, financing, stock markets, and so on. It can be categorized right into different types: For more details please refer to the adhering to article Categories of Software.
It is defined by a structured, sequential method to project management and software program growth. It is excellent to use this design when the technology is well understood.
Beta screening commonly utilizes black-box screening. Beta testing is carried out at the end-user, the of the item.
Dependability, protection, and effectiveness are inspected during beta screening. Alpha testing makes certain the top quality of the item prior to forwarding it to beta testing. Beta testing additionally focuses on the top quality of the product however gathers the individual's time-long input on the product and guarantees that the product awaits real-time users.
Table of Contents
Latest Posts
Senior Software Engineer Interview Study Plan – A Complete Guide
5 Ways To Use Chatgpt For Software Engineer Interview Preparation
Jane Street Software Engineering Mock Interview – A Detailed Walkthrough
More
Latest Posts
Senior Software Engineer Interview Study Plan – A Complete Guide
5 Ways To Use Chatgpt For Software Engineer Interview Preparation
Jane Street Software Engineering Mock Interview – A Detailed Walkthrough